Output 92a806daa0693f54a0a5d022b11259900a4945b3cd33dd36196743d713e28646:11

value
849403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d7ba36a267f30f93b3f7ef19a6930deb84400d OP_EQUAL
address
3DyzuFXbJNaSNeB6B4iNmVgnBmfL8thecW
transaction
92a806daa0693f54a0a5d022b11259900a4945b3cd33dd36196743d713e28646
confirmations
342071
spent
true